As I go further in life and eventually reach my career goal of being an athletic director I think some of the things I've learned in this class will aid me. One topic that we talked about that I think will help me most is Title IX and schools losing programs. As an AD it would be my responsibility to make sure the school complies with the rules of Title IX and has enough money to keep other programs up and running. I would hate to be in a situation where I had to make a final decision on cutting a program. So I will do anything I can to make sure that every program has enough finances to operate through booster clubs and other ways of funding and if necessary cutting jobs that aren't as necessary as others. This is a real problem that I may one day have to face and I'm glad I got some perspective on it.
